Authorities have banned counterfeit weight-loss medications, including replicas of popular drugs like Ozempic and Mounjaro, in a move affecting roughly 20,000 Australians.
Ozempic and Mounjaro , which are diabetes drugs, have gained immense popularity both domestically and globally for their remarkable weight-loss effects.
Novo Nordisk, the exclusive manufacturer of Ozempic and the patent holder for semaglutide, has declared in a statement it does not supply the ingredient to pharmacies. Adverse side effects have led to warnings from authorities about the use of these white-label alternatives. Pharmacies found flouting this regulation post-October risk facing severe civil and criminal penalties under the Therapeutic Goods Act.
